
CATs are meetings set up at certain times throughout the year which help to ensure that we have a better understanding of the needs of Fareham residents and communities. The meetings give us a chance to hear from you and for you to hear from us. It is hoped that they will make a real difference to residents and their communities. There is also the opportunity to bid for Community Funding. Funding can only be used for capital projects.

Any resident, or organisation based in the Borough of Fareham can apply for money from the Community Fund. Money will not be handed over to an individual; it will be given to the club/contractor or organisation. If applying for more than £5,000, you will be expected to contribute at least the same amount of money to the project from other sources
Contact your local Community Action Team Officer on 01329 236100 or email cats@fareham.gov.uk.to discuss your project. If it is agreed that you can apply for funding your CAT Officer will be able to help you to complete the application form.
You can only apply for funding to meet 'one off' capital costs. For example if you think your club house/village hall requires a new kitchen, a bid can be placed, however, if granted, the club/association would then be responsible for any upkeep and maintenance of the new kitchen.

Each meeting will be different as the agenda will be set from issues raised at the previous meeting. However, at every meeting there will be an opportunity for you to ask any questions you may have. Each meeting will be supported by the police, who will feedback on crime figures in the area and respond to any queries you may have.
Your local councillors will chair the meetings
